// This test case makes sure that two identical invocations of the compiler | ||
// (i.e. same code base, same compile-flags, same compiler-versions, etc.) | ||
// produce the same output. In the past, symbol names of monomorphized functions | ||
// were not deterministic (which we want to avoid). | ||
// | ||
// The test tries to exercise as many different paths into symbol name | ||
// generation as possible: | ||
// | ||
// - regular functions | ||
// - generic functions | ||
// - methods | ||
// - statics | ||
// - closures | ||
// - enum variant constructors | ||
// - tuple struct constructors | ||
// - drop glue | ||
// - FnOnce adapters | ||
// - Trait object shims | ||
// - Fn Pointer shims | ||
